Queens Park Rangers see off Middlesbrough

Queens Park Rangers earn a 2-0 victory over Middlesbrough at Loftus Road to stay top of the Championship table.

Queens Park Rangers have beaten Middlesbrough 2-0 in this afternoon's Championship clash at Loftus Road.

Joey Barton gave the home side the lead after four minutes when his strike found the net after taking a deflection of Frazer Richardson.

Charlie Austin doubled the their lead 10 minutes before the break from the penalty spot after Ben Gibson was penalised for a handball.

Lukas Jutkiewicz went close for the visitors after the break but his low effort was held by Robert Green.

Gary O'Neil had a chance to add a third goal for the hosts but was denied his first goal for the club when Luke Steele tipped his strike over.
